Abstract
A nasal mask of the type for delivering gas for example to ease or assist the breathing process includes a shell and a cushion connected with the shell. The shell has a side wall and a retaining ring disposed inside the side wall. The side wall and the retaining ring define a gap extending around the shell. The cushion has a side wall with an outer peripheral edge portion including a tongue extending around the cushion. The tongue of the cushion is received in the gap in the shell to secure the cushion to the shell. Various straps assemblies and forehead adjusters for nasal masks are also shown.

3. A nasal mask including:
-
a shell; and a cushion connected with said shell for engagement with the face of a user; said cushion having a side wall, an inner wall extending from the side wall transverse to said side wall, and an outer wall extending from the side wall transverse to said side wall; wherein said outer wall is defined by first and second sides that are spaced apart by a thickness of the outer wall, wherein said first side of the outer wall is adapted to engage and seal against a face of a user of the mask; wherein both of said first and second sides of said outer wall of said cushion extend from said side wall extending completely around said cushion; wherein said inner wall is defined by first and second sides that are spaced apart by a thickness of the inner wall, wherein said first side of said inner wall is spaced apart from said second side of said outer wall; wherein both of said first and second sides of said inner wall of said cushion are discontinuous in a nasal bridge region of said cushion, such that a gap is formed between ends of the inner wall in said nasal bridge region. - View Dependent Claims (4, 5, 6, 7, 8, 9, 10)
